Not always true, even with Ridge! I just attended a Jimsomare Vineyard tasting (both zins and cabs), and the two oldest Zins tasted, the 1968 and 1970, were 15% and 15.8%, respectively. Didn't taste like it, though, very well balanced and still alive.
On the other hand, three vintages from the early '80's were all
under 12%. Go figure.
